Technology Roadmap Development
Overview / Trends / Challenges
Technology roadmaps have evolved from static IT plans to dynamic tools driving innovation and investment prioritization. Organizations must anticipate rapid shifts in AI, cloud-native computing, and cybersecurity threats while aligning with business strategy. 
 The biggest challenge today is balancing future-tech readiness with current resource constraints. Without a clear roadmap, digital initiatives risk fragmentation, technical debt, or misaligned outcomes.
Insights
- 82% of CIOs identify roadmap agility as critical to future competitiveness.
- A well-structured tech roadmap improves investment ROI by aligning with strategic business priorities.
- Regulatory changes, AI ethics, and sustainability targets now influence tech planning.
- Roadmaps must include cross-functional dependencies, risk buffers, and innovation funnels.
- Tech debt visibility and modernization sequencing are key components of next-gen roadmaps.
